πŸ“Œ Part I: Product Definition & The Classification Dilemma

A Portable High Pressure Cleaner is a versatile cleaning device used for removing dirt, grime, and debris from surfaces. In international trade, its classification is highly contentious because it sits at the intersection of household appliances and industrial cleaning machinery.

The core debate lies in whether the device is classified as: 1. An Electrical Appliance (Heading 8509): Defined by its self-contained electric motor and household/portable nature. 2. A Mechanical Spraying Device (Heading 8424): Defined by its function of projecting or dispersing fluids under pressure.

⚠️ Critical Distinction:
- If classified as 8509, the tax burden may be significantly lower due to differentι™„εŠ η¨Ž (supplementary tariffs).
- If classified as 8424, the product faces steep Section 301 (25%) and 122 Clause (10%) tariffs, leading to high overall costs.
- Misclassification Risk: Declaring a high-pressure washer as "household appliance" to avoid tariffs, when it functions primarily as a mechanical sprayer, can lead to customs audits, back-taxes, and penalties.

πŸ› οΈ Part IV: Customs Clearance Practical Advice (Avoiding Pitfalls)

βœ… 1. Preparation Checklist (Mandatory Documents)

Document Required? Notes
βœ… Product Specification Sheet βœ”οΈ Must detail motor wattage, pressure (PSI/Bar), flow rate, and power source.
βœ… Photos & Images βœ”οΈ Show the unit, control panel, hose, and nozzle. Highlight "Portable" features.
βœ… Commercial Invoice βœ”οΈ Clearly state "Portable High Pressure Cleaner" and intended use (e.g., "Household/Commercial Cleaning").
βœ… Bill of Lading / Air Waybill βœ”οΈ Standard shipping document.
βœ… Origin Certificate βœ”οΈ Confirm Chinese origin to apply correct Section 301 status.
βœ… Circuit Diagram (if possible) βœ”οΈ Helps prove it is an electrical appliance (8509) rather than just a mechanical pump (8424).

βœ… 3. Special Cases

Case Handling Advice
OEM/Private Label Provide brand authorization and technical sheets to support "Household Appliance" classification.
Battery-Powered (Cordless) Still generally falls under 8509 if it has a self-contained motor. Ensure battery safety data sheets (MSDS) are ready.
Water Heater Included? If it has a built-in heating element, it may still be 8509, but ensure it's not classified as a "Boiler" (8402).
Importing for Personal Use? Same rules apply. No de minimis exemption for these codes.

About HS Code Classification

The Harmonized System (HS) is an internationally standardized nomenclature developed by the World Customs Organization (WCO) to classify traded products. Over 200 countries use the HS system as the basis for customs tariffs, trade statistics, and import/export regulations.

Each HS code follows a hierarchical structure:

  • Chapter (2 digits) β€” Broad category of goods (e.g., Chapter 84: Machinery and Mechanical Appliances)
  • Heading (4 digits) β€” More specific grouping within the chapter
  • Subheading (6 digits) β€” Internationally standardized breakdown, used by all WCO member countries
  • National subdivisions (8-10 digits) β€” Country-specific extensions for further classification, such as US HTSUS 10-digit codes

Correct HS code classification is essential for smooth customs clearance, accurate duty payment, and compliance with trade regulations. Misclassification can lead to customs delays, overpayment of duties, or penalties.
